86 Watch Order

The suggested watch order for 86 is quite simple: just follow the release order, which aligns with the chronological timeline:

OrderTitleEpisodesAir Date186 (Part 1)Episodes 1-11April 11 – June 20, 2021286 (Part 2)Episodes 12-23October 3, 2021 – March 19, 2022

Note about recap specials: There were 4 special edition episodes aired during the anime’s run. These special episodes are not crucial viewing as they are recaps and cast commentaries made to fill in time due to production delays. You can easily skip them without losing any story content.

86 Special Episodes Breakdown (Optional):

  • Episode 11.5 “The Poppies Bloom Red on the Battlefield” (June 27, 2021) – Recap of Part 1
  • Episode 17.5 “Visual Commentary Special Episode” (November 14, 2021) – Recap of Part 2’s first six episodes with visual commentary from voice actors Shōya Chiba (Shinei Nouzen), Seiichirō Yamashita (Raiden Shuga), and Misaki Kuno (Frederica Rosenfort), plus merchandise promotion
  • Episode 18.5 “If There’s Something Worth Dying For” (November 28, 2021) – Recap of Part 2’s first seven episodes
  • Episode 21.5 “At Least as a Human” (March 5, 2022) – Recap of Part 2’s episodes 7 through 10

The first season of 86 includes 23 episodes that aired from April 2021 to March 2022, adapting the initial three volumes of Asato Asato’s light novel series:

  • Episodes 1-11 (Cour 1) ≈ Volume 1 of the light novel (with some alterations/omissions)
  • Episodes 12-23 (Cour 2) ≈ Volumes 2 & 3 of the light novel, covering the second arc

As of October 2025, the 86 – Eighty-Six light novel series has published 14 volumes in Japan, with Volume 14, titled “Paint It Black”, initiating the final arc (released in September 2025). In English, Yen Press has released up to Volume 13, with further volumes anticipated. The series is currently entering its concluding arc, indicating there is still substantial source material available for future anime seasons to adapt.

Where to Continue After the Anime

Light Novel

If you wish to extend the story after the anime, begin reading from Volume 4: “Under Pressure”. While the anime is regarded as an excellent and faithful adaptation, certain details were streamlined or omitted for pacing. If time permits, starting from Volume 1 will provide you with the comprehensive experience along with additional context and character insights.

Manga

The manga adaptation by Motoki Yoshihara only encompasses a small segment of the storyline. The manga was cancelled in June 2021 due to the author’s health issues after just three volumes, making it unsuitable as a means to continue the narrative. The light novel remains the best option for following beyond the anime.

Where to Watch 86

You can stream all 23 episodes of 86 – Eighty-Six Season 1 on Crunchyroll, which offers both subtitled and dubbed versions. The series is also accessible on Amazon Prime Video in select regions.
